接口字段html文件,前后端交互接口规范

本文详细介绍了前后端交互接口的标准,包括静态HTML页面的数据请求与返回、静态资源请求、数据提交方式、参数传递、浏览器缓存处理以及交互数据格式,如分页、排序和表格数据的规范。旨在确保高效、一致的接口通信。
摘要由CSDN通过智能技术生成

## 一、交互标准

### 1、对于静态HTML/XML页面的数据请求与返回

前端请求一个HTML/XML等文本格式页面用于渲染时,请统一使用GET请求。

文本页面编码除特殊情况外,一律采用UTF-8编码格式。

在后端返回的HTTP数据中,请确保Content-Type被设置并且为text/html,application/xhtml+xml或application/xml中的任意一个符合当前页面格式的值,并且正确显示的设置了编码,如下:

`Content-Type:text/html;charset=UTF-8`

### 2、对于静态资源的请求与返回

前端可以使用静态或动态添加方式,发起对一个或多个静态资源的请求。请遵循标准的的HTML标签规范确保携带正确的Accept头部信息。

后端根据指定的URI返回与前端正确的文件。如果出现未找到文件的情况,请按照HTTP标准返回404错误信息。

### 3、对于数据提交

前端提交数据,按情况可以使用表单提交或者Ajax传输方式。如果使用表单提交,请确保提交的Content-Type为application/x-www-form-urlencoded或multipart/form-data(用于伴随文件或者其他附加信息的提交)。

使用Ajax提交数据时,请确保预期的返回数据在HTTP请求头的Accept字段的首部。例如预期返回为json数据,则头部Accept字段可以如下:

`Accept:application/json, */*;`

### 4、请求中的参数

请遵守HTTP协议的参数传递并使用默认的参数传递分隔方式。在通常情况下,请不要在HTTP报文头部信息中放置自

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值